IMO--I don't think there is any advantage to 26" wheels. I have a high quality set of 700c wheels that are probably stronger than most stock 26" wheels. I also don't plan on using a tire wider than 32mm for touring. They are a good compromise between weight and comfort.

Part of our route last summer took us over 400+ miles of this type of road and trails. Also about 500 miles of cobblestones and paver block roads and trails.
